linux查看服务的服务名
时间: 2023-09-28 19:03:33 浏览: 279
你可以使用以下命令来查看 Linux 系统中的服务名:
1. systemctl list-units --type=service:列出所有正在运行的服务。
2. systemctl list-unit-files --type=service:列出所有可用的服务。
3. service --status-all:列出所有已安装的服务的状态。
4. chkconfig --list:列出所有已安装的服务的级别和状态。
5. ps aux | grep [s]ervice_name:查找指定服务的进程 ID。
请注意,其中的“service_name”应替换为您要查找的服务的名称。
相关问题
Linux查看oracle数据库服务名
在 Linux 上查看 Oracle 数据库服务名,可以通过以下步骤:
1. 打开终端,使用 `su` 命令切换到 Oracle 数据库的安装用户。例如,如果你的 Oracle 用户名是 `oracle`,可以执行以下命令切换到该用户:
```
su - oracle
```
2. 执行以下命令来连接到 Oracle 数据库:
```
sqlplus / as sysdba
```
3. 输入数据库管理员密码,然后按 Enter 键登录到数据库。
4. 运行以下 SQL 查询语句来获取数据库服务名:
```
SELECT name FROM v$database;
```
这将返回数据库的服务名。
5. 退出 SQL*Plus 命令行界面,可以使用以下命令:
```
exit
```
请注意,需要具有适当的权限才能执行上述步骤。此外,确保已正确安装和配置了 Oracle 数据库。
如何查看linux下已启动服务名字
你可以使用以下命令来查看Linux下已启动服务的名称:
```
systemctl list-units --type=service --state=running
```
这个命令会列出所有正在运行的服务的名称。如果你只想查看特定服务的名称,可以将命令中的 `--state=running` 替换为服务的名称,例如:
```
systemctl status sshd.service
```
这个命令会显示 sshd 服务的状态,包括服务名字。